+using System;
+
+public class CheckedUnchecked
+{
+ public int Operators(int a, int b)
+ {
+ int num = checked(a + b);
+ int num2 = a + b;
+ int num3 = checked(a - b);
+ int num4 = a - b;
+ int num5 = checked(a * b);
+ int num6 = a * b;
+ int num7 = a / b;
+ int num8 = a % b;
+ // The division operators / and % only exist in one form (checked vs. unchecked doesn't matter for them)
+ return num * num2 * num3 * num4 * num5 * num6 * num7 * num8;
+ }
+
+ public int Cast(int a)
+ {
+ short num = checked((short)a);
+ short num2 = (short)a;
+ byte b = checked((byte)a);
+ byte b2 = (byte)a;
+ return num * num2 * b * b2;
+ }
+
+ public void ForWithCheckedIteratorAndUncheckedBody(int n)
+ {
+ checked
+ {
+ for (int i = n + 1; i < n + 1; i++)
+ {
+ n = unchecked(i * i);
+ }
+ }
+ }
+
+ public void ForWithCheckedInitializerAndUncheckedIterator(int n)
+ {
+ checked
+ {
+ int i = n;
+ for (i -= 10; i < n; i = unchecked(i + 1))
+ {
+ n--;
+ }
+ }
+ }
+ public void ObjectCreationInitializerChecked()
+ {
+ this.TestHelp(new
+ {
+ x = 0,
+ l = 0
+ }, n => checked(new
+ {
+ x = n.x + 1,
+ l = n.l + 1
+ }));
+ }
+
+ public void ObjectCreationWithOneFieldChecked()
+ {
+ this.TestHelp(new
+ {
+ x = 0,
+ l = 0
+ }, n => new
+ {
+ x = checked(n.x + 1),
+ l = n.l + 1
+ });
+ }
+
+
+ public void ArrayInitializerChecked()
+ {
+ this.TestHelp<int[]>(new int[]
+ {
+ 1,
+ 2
+ }, (int[] n) => checked(new int[]
+ {
+ n[0] + 1,
+ n[1] + 1
+ }));
+ }
+
+ public T TestHelp<T>(T t, Func<T, T> f)
+ {
+ return f(t);
+ }
+
+ public void CheckedInArrayCreationArgument(int a, int b)
+ {
+ Console.WriteLine(new int[checked(a + b)]);
+ }
+}
